论坛首页 综合技术论坛

一道24点的10+种非人类解法(2,3,10,10)

浏览 24912 次
精华帖 (5)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
作者 正文
   发表时间:2011-06-09  
XJHH 写道
tomleader 写道
这题是明显 的题意交代不清楚,原题应该是,用加减乘除四种运算符号来组合计算的,而LZ用了4种基本运算之外的运算符,当然会有其他解法了


如果老是只想着用加减乘除的话,这叫思维定势,为什么现在人们老是说现在是应试教育呢,就是不能扩展学生的思维,只会死用课本的东西,并不能综合灵活运用学过的东西.

假如出一道题就叫24点算法,人家是要的是结果,加、减、乘、除、阶乘、乘方等等都只是一个工具。
就好比做项目,客户只要一个结果,你和java、C、.Net等等都只是一个工具而已.还有其中的算法也是自己设计.

我只是想说明一个要把自己的思维扩散来,不要被限制了.



    恩,咱思考的是不同的角度,24点游戏最初是来自玩扑克牌的一种益智游戏,但凡是游戏就会有规则,就好像咱的围棋,有个轮流下子的规则,咱是不是可以考虑说这个太束缚思维了,应该让每个人想下几个子就下几个子?可这样一来,这个游戏就失去了乐趣和意义,同理,24点不限制运算符的情况下,咱也可以自定义一个运算符,使得它只返回24,这样也是无敌的解法(楼上有兄弟也想到自定义函数,return 24,也是无敌解法)。
    没什么问题,既然规则没明确限制,这样做无可厚非,只是这样一来24点也就失去了惊喜,失去了乐趣。 关于导数阶乘的通解很久以前就有了,所以看到帖子并没多大惊奇。我觉得更令我惊呀的是网友们强大的想象力,以及思维发散的程度,我觉得已经可以达到宇宙边沿了。就好像那个讨论猪过桥的问题一样。见仁见智。
0 请登录后投票
   发表时间:2011-06-12  
tomleader 写道

    恩,咱思考的是不同的角度,24点游戏最初是来自玩扑克牌的一种益智游戏,但凡是游戏就会有规则,就好像咱的围棋,有个轮流下子的规则,咱是不是可以考虑说这个太束缚思维了,应该让每个人想下几个子就下几个子?可这样一来,这个游戏就失去了乐趣和意义,同理,24点不限制运算符的情况下,咱也可以自定义一个运算符,使得它只返回24,这样也是无敌的解法(楼上有兄弟也想到自定义函数,return 24,也是无敌解法)。
    没什么问题,既然规则没明确限制,这样做无可厚非,只是这样一来24点也就失去了惊喜,失去了乐趣。 关于导数阶乘的通解很久以前就有了,所以看到帖子并没多大惊奇。我觉得更令我惊呀的是网友们强大的想象力,以及思维发散的程度,我觉得已经可以达到宇宙边沿了。就好像那个讨论猪过桥的问题一样。见仁见智。


第一 游戏是有规则的
第二 规则是可以改变和完善的,比方增加 乘方、开方、阶乘、三角函数 等等运算符
第三 改变游戏规则时 不能胡搅蛮缠,比方“自定义一个运算符,使得它只返回24”
0 请登录后投票
   发表时间:2011-06-14  
adventurelw 写道
cttnbcj 写道
玩的花点  x=3 (∫(10-2)dx + 10')

这个不是不定积分么,没有上下限如何求值?再求导一次积分就是多余了。

  虽然我学这个没几月,但是也知道这个是不定积分。。。。。。。。。。。。
0 请登录后投票
   发表时间:2011-06-14  
cttnbcj 写道
adventurelw 写道
cttnbcj 写道
玩的花点  x=3 (∫(10-2)dx + 10')

这个不是不定积分么,没有上下限如何求值?再求导一次积分就是多余了。

  虽然我学这个没几月,但是也知道这个是不定积分。。。。。。。。。。。。

他那个求导符号标错了,应该括号外面。
0 请登录后投票
   发表时间:2011-06-17  
这里看到一个算24点的程序,PHP的,一个强悍的算24点游戏的PHP程序
0 请登录后投票
   发表时间:2011-06-19  
我泪奔了........................
0 请登录后投票
   发表时间:2011-06-19  
一般算24点,都是限定只能加减乘除,最多带括号的吧
0 请登录后投票
   发表时间:2011-06-23  
你们都是兽!!!我要回去学高数!
0 请登录后投票
论坛首页 综合技术版

跳转论坛:
Global site tag (gtag.js) - Google Analytics